This might take a while though, as I just > > started this project last weekend... :-) > > > > As for your question why we have only 737's for AI traffic. The reason is > > that > > most of the traffic manager AI is in a relatively early stage of > > development and the supplied patterns serve mainly as a proof of > > principle. The 737 is one of the aircraft that is supplied by default in > > the base package. > > > > With the new traffic pattern editor, I'm moving away from the idea of > > using regular aircraft for AI traffic, but use dedicated AI models, which > > are somewhat lower in detail, because they're not regularly seen from > > small distances. However, this is again still in it's early stages. > > > > Cheers, > > Durk > > > > On Monday 31 October 2005 01:25, [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: > > > Hi Durk > > > > > > Thank you very much for the explanation - Let me know if you need a > > > hand with the AI part of FlightGear.
